Step 4: Configure FixtureForge. The FixtureForge library seeds deterministic test data into the staging schema before each deploy at Quellworth Systems. Copy env.sample to .env in the fixtureforge directory and fill in the database host and pool size as documented. Then add the signing secret as the next line of the .env file.

sealed setting: RELAY_SECRET5=82864

## Webhook Delivery Retries — Release Notes

As a contractor on the Pipegale delivery service, note that webhooks retry with exponential backoff: five attempts over roughly fifteen minutes, then the event parks in the dead-letter queue. Releases must not change this cadence without a migration note, since downstream partners tune their idempotency windows to it. Before deploying, verify the retry config checksum, then authorize the rollout by signing the release manifest with the deploy key below.

rollout seal: bky4_x7Gc

14:22 — Offline sync regression confirmed (Terrapath field-survey app)

At 14:22 the on-call engineer reproduced the data-loss path: surveys saved while offline were marked synced once connectivity returned, even when the upload was rejected. The queue flush skipped the server acknowledgement check introduced in the previous sprint. Release manager note: the fix must ship before the coastal survey season. The offending build is identified by the token recorded below.

session token of kawif-fawig = htk31_f3f599be2b1a34affb1efa8d0feccf8

Subject: Quickstore 4.2 — bloom filter now fronts the KV layer

Plugin authors: starting with this release, Quickstore places a bloom filter ahead of the key-value store. Negative lookups return faster; false positives fall through safely. No API changes are required on your side. Verify your plugin against the staging build referenced below.

session token of fahif-tadup = htk3_9c7

## Date localization

Fenwick Portal renders dates per-locale via the Chronoform service. If users report wrong formats, confirm the locale pack loaded and restart chronoform-render. Do not patch templates directly. Format resolution is driven by the following configuration values:

settings of kagup-tagug:
ULAIX_HOST=ulaix.zemvarsys.internal
ULAIX_PORT=8000